DPR Korea Tour, a website operated by North Korea's tourism authority, says the Wonsan-Kalma coastal resort is "temporarily not receiving foreign tourists".
Wonsan Kalma, with a 2.5 mile beach, is one of Kim Jong-un's most-discussed tourism projects, but the only foreign visitors allowed so far have been Russians.
